How do you stretch out shorts?

It is recommended that the shorts be turned inside out and that a steamer be used to saturate the waistband until it is warm and damp. It is important to ensure that the steamer is moved around to avoid overheating.

How do you stretch denim shorts to the thighs?

To stretch denim jeans, fill a spray bottle with lukewarm water and spray the desired area. This should be done by wearing the jeans or gently pulling them with your hands. Steam jeans, if you don’t have a spray bottle, by steaming them over an ironing board or chair. The waistband should be damp and stretched to the desired size. If pulling at the jeans isn’t appealing, insert rolled-up towels, newspapers, or pillows into the waist or thigh area when not wearing them. This can be done overnight or during the day when you’re at work to maintain the stretched-out shape.

How to make tight jeans looser?

To stretch cotton jeans, wet them and stretch the tight parts, either by tugging them or wearing them wet and moving around or squatting. Jean size is erratic, and sticking to a set size can be challenging. To ensure a perfect fit, most jeans can be stretched from an inch to one and a half inches from almost every part, depending on the fabric. If you need more than this, you might need to buy a new pair of jeans.

How do you make denim clothes bigger?

To stretch jeans, use a spray bottle filled with warm water and strategically pull on the fabric in the areas you want to stretch. Wear the jeans until they dry. If you don’t have a spray bottle, blow the heat onto the areas you want to stretch. Use your hands to pull and stretch tight areas. Waistband stretchers, similar to shoes stretchers, can be used to stretch jeans. Wet the waistband with lukewarm water, insert the stretcher, and turn the handle to expand. Leave the stretcher inserted overnight or check back in and give it more turns every few hours if needed. This method can help clients gain up to an inch on their waist and more in their wallet.

Does 100% denim stretch?

Denim jeans stretch slightly over time, with cotton being the most stretchy. However, denim with a 4-way composition can hold their shape for years. Cotton denim stretches the most, while synthetic denim with a mix of materials holds shape and fits the body when washed according to care instructions. Stretch denim jeans generally have flexibility, so choosing a regular size is usually suitable, as sizing down could result in an uncomfortable fit.

Can a tailor make denim bigger?

A tailor can make jeans waist bigger by reducing the waistband by opening it up, removing excess fabric, and reattaching it for a snugger fit. If the jeans are too tight, the waist can be expanded by adding a small fabric panel or adjusting the existing fabric, provided there’s enough allowance. Adjusting the waist helps the jeans sit comfortably without gaping at the back or pinching at the sides.
